Clemar Travel
Closed
8600 Keele St
Vaughan, Ontario L4K 2N2
Clemar Travel is a travel agency based in Concord, ON, offering a range of travel services to its clients.
Specializing in personalized travel planning and booking, Clemar Travel aims to assist customers in creating memorable and stress-free travel experiences.
Generated from their business information
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2024. All rights reserved.